Pediatric School-Based Speech-Language Pathologist - Atlanta, Georgia

Soliant Health

Embark on a rewarding contract opportunity making an impact in students' lives! Several onsite Speech-Language Pathologist openings are available for the 2026-2027 school year, with a range of positions serving elementary, middle, and high schools. Collaborate within an engaged educational community just south of Atlanta-an easy commute from surrounding cities such as Decatur and Peachtree City.


As a valued member of the team, you'll work 40 hours per week from July 27, 2026, through May 26, 2027, delivering critical services that support student growth and achievement. Both SLP-CCC and Clinical Fellowship Year (CFY) candidates are encouraged to apply, with the chance for mentorship and professional development.


Desired Qualifications:

  • Master's degree in Speech-Language Pathology
  • Valid Georgia SLP license and ASHA Certificate of Clinical Competence, or eligibility for CFY supervision
  • Experience in school settings preferred (elementary, middle, or high school)
  • Strong skills in teletherapy, pediatric care, and healthcare aspects of SLP
  • Ability to collaborate with educators, families, and other specialists
  • Excellent communication, organization, and documentation skills
Key Responsibilities:
  • Provide direct speech-language services to students, onsite
  • Conduct comprehensive evaluations and develop individualized treatment plans
  • Collaborate with teachers, administrators, and parents to support student progress
  • Maintain accurate records and contribute to IEP meetings
  • Utilize teletherapy tools as needed to facilitate student access
  • Foster a positive and inclusive environment for students of varied backgrounds
Benefits include:
  • Supportive multidisciplinary team
  • CFY supervision and mentorship available
  • Opportunities for professional growth
  • Diverse caseloads across different age groups
